For now I&#8217;m posting it as is, warts and all, but eventually I plan to revise it and maybe even run it (crazy, I know).<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>I WAS A TEENAGE WEREFROG<\/strong>&nbsp;<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>Introduction<br><\/strong>This is an investigative scenario with the premise that a UA lycanthrope, played straight, is weird enough to be the entire crux of a mystery. Set it anywhere in suburban America.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>Objectives<\/strong><br>Here are several possible setups for the scenario, plus associated objectives.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">A Sleeper cell from out of town: Make sure \u201cThe Kevin Situation\u201d doesn\u2019t wake the tiger. Starts at 20% due to being grounded in the unnatural from the outset.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Local rubberneckers about to have their trigger event: Find out the truth behind Kevin Liao\u2019s disappearance. Starts at 10% due to the reduced firehose of new faces and names to keep track of.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Private investigators hired by Kevin\u2019s father because he\u2019s noticed his son has abruptly stopped spending his money: Find Kevin Liao and make sure he\u2019s safe. Starts at 0%.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Note the different implications about possible resolutions.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>Timeline of Events<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">13 days ago: Kevin meets Patricia Albrici at a Humphrey Bogart marathon at local indie theater UnReel. She uses him to charge but he realizes she\u2019s magick and insists she teach him.&nbsp;<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">10 days ago: Patricia gets sick of Kevin following her around and lures him into conducting a ritual that gets him possessed by a lycanthropic demon.&nbsp;<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">9 days ago: Kevin transforms for the first time. He spends 9 hours as a bullfrog in the O\u2019Neils\u2019 house over the weekend without attracting special attention, then reverts.&nbsp;<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">7 days ago: The demon takes over Kevin\u2019s body for about two hours before school. It uses this time to make meticulous notes in Portuguese on all of the children in his neighborhood and plans to abduct and murder them. After school, Kevin takes the time to translate a couple sentences of this weird stuff he doesn\u2019t remember writing, freaks out, and returns to UnReel to try and get answers. He holes up in a disused projection room.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">6 days ago: Patricia manages to duck Kevin\u2019s notice at UnReel thanks to a deployment of random magick (\u201cI\u2019ve got a bad feeling about this\u2026\u201d). She begins asking checkers if Kevin has done anything bad that could be traced back to her and buys a \u201csexy cop\u201d Halloween costume.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">&nbsp;5 days ago: Having learned that Kevin\u2019s been absent from school for several days, Patricia dons her \u201cOfficer Albrici\u201d persona using the Stock Wardrobe spell and does damage control at Kevin\u2019s school while she tries to find out more.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">&nbsp;3 days ago: The demon regains control of Kevin, sneaks out of UnReel in the dead of night, sneaks up to a house to snatch a toddler, then gets displaced by the bullfrog\u2019s spirit, which idly stares into the window for four hours. Kevin reasserts himself just before daybreak and flees, though several neighbors saw him in bullfrog form.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Yesterday: The demon wins out again. It uses Kevin to snatch a different child, Kaighley Vass, and then butcher her with a garden trowel. Kevin comes back to himself in the midst of scattering the pieces at a trash dump. He runs off into the woods in the midst of a total mental breakdown.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>GMCs<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Ruoxi \u201cKevin\u201d Liao: A Chinese foreign exchange student-cum-were-bullfrog. He attends Angus Academy on the dime of his father, the CEO of a major rail company. Even before his lycanthropy, he was a bit of a wild child. He deliberately flunks math and science just to buck stereotypes, and has adopted a slightly ridiculous \u201cAll-American\u201d persona to try and fit in; he feigns passion for baseball, Westerns, and the Rolling Stones.<br>His dream is to become a bigshot Hollywood director; he really loves Tarantino. Most likely, he\u2019s somewhere on the Autism spectrum and he self-medicates with weed in the school parking lot. Lots of people know&nbsp;<br><em>about<\/em> him, but nobody knows him <em>well<\/em>.For a week and a half, he\u2019s had to share his body with a sadistic and murderous demon and the mellow spirit of a bullfrog.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><br>\u201cDetective\u201d Patricia Albrici: A cinemancer (Book 1: Play, p. 148) with a penchant for gritty crime flicks and a complicated relationship with the prevalence of misogynist themes often found therein. She knows there\u2019s a demon in Kevin, but not that it\u2019s lycanthropic.&nbsp;<br>Alongside Terry Kidd and Patrick O\u2019Neil, she\u2019s inserted herself into the hush-hush management of Kevin\u2019s disappearance as \u201cDetective Albrici,\u201d and won their trust and silence. She takes her cue for this performance from <em>Fargo<\/em> (the movie, not the show, of course). She\u2019s starting to freak out about the lack of news regarding Kevin\u2019s whereabouts that her occult underground contacts have brought her. When she finds out about the dead little girl, she\u2019ll go apeshit.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Patrick, Lena, and Conrad O\u2019Brien: Kevin\u2019s host family. They never saw much of him, which Lena finds sad and Conrad is amused by. Patrick, a workaholic corporate lawyer, doesn\u2019t even know that Kevin is fluent in English. Lena volunteered to host Kevin because she hoped he\u2019d be a well-behaved geek who might bring Conrad in line. For his part, Conrad is more or less a pampered neo-nazi with aspirations in what is to him a political environment full of promise.With Kevin gone a week, Patrick has begrudgingly starting pulling strings to keep things quiet; he wants to avoid Kevin\u2019s father finding out what\u2019s going on at all costs.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Terrence Kidd: The principal of Kevin\u2019s school. Like Patrick, he was late to hear about \u201cThe Kevin Situation,\u201d but is going out of his way to keep it under wraps. A surprisingly spry Vietnam vet, he wishes he got to run the school like a boot camp and grouses often about participation trophies and the like.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Stepan Kovac: The media studies teacher. As a Slovakian immigrant, he\u2019s sympathetic to Kevin\u2019s struggles fitting in. He recently agreed to supervise Kevin on an independent study to shoot a feature film, with the hopes he can elevate the boy\u2019s taste above derivative film bro crap. Now that Kevin is missing, he\u2019s sweating bullets, fearing how their relatively close relationship might reflect on him. He\u2019s also the one person really invested in making sure Kevin is safe and accounted for. So far he\u2019s been trying to snoop around on his own, but he\u2019s reached the conclusion he\u2019ll probably have to come clean to \u201cDetective\u201d Albrici at some point.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Kai McDowell, Dong \u201cGeorge\u201d Feng, Nicole Dittmar: Kevin\u2019s hangers-on, or what pass for his friends. Respectively, a nihilistic nonbinary senior who\u2019s checked out of their life until college; a homesick fellow Chinese exchange student whose rebellious streak has just about petered out; and a freshman who\u2019s crushing on Kevin, albeit in a creepy, orientalist way. Since he stopped coming to school, they\u2019ve enjoyed debating what exactly was wrong with him, and where he might have gone.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>Key Locations<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Angus Academy: The private school Kevin attends. An odd amalgamation; teaching styles range from old-fashioned and conservative to loosey-goosey, post-Montessori weirdness. Its students are roughly 80% filthy rich American kids, 10% filthy rich foreign exchange students (like Kevin) and 10% the offspring of teachers and staff (who get free tuition as a benefit).<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Sentry Street: The affluent cul-de-sac where Kevin lives with his host family, the O\u2019Neils. Also the home of the family that bullrog-Kevin stared at three days ago and the Vasses, whose daughter is missing, because demon-Kevin killed her.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">UnReel: The indie movie theater where Kevin met Patricia Albrici, and where he\u2019s spent a lot of the last week and a half. It used to be a big attraction listed in guidebooks, but now half the rooms are shut down and its only staff is its geriatric owner and a couple of part-time college students.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">The Woods: Kevin\u2019s current location. Really, it would be more accurate to call it \u201cThe Park,\u201d because it\u2019s well-maintained and nearby homeowners like to call the cops on people who walk their dogs off-leash. Needless to say, Kevin will have to move on soon.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>Complications<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Sprinkle some or all of the following in as pacing and bungled investigation demand (other than Transformation, which has to happen):<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Ribbit: Every time Kevin tranforms into a frog or gets possessed by the killer demon inside him, the surrounding area is beset by unnatural phenomena: the buzzing of nonexistent flies fills the air and patches of the ground or floor turn into swamp muck and cattails (permanently). If the demon takes over or Kevin is reverting to himself, a physical quirk lingers for 1d10 minutes, such as a long, prehensile tongue or webbed digits. If he\u2019s turning into a bullfrog, it\u2019s the inverse, such as 1d10 minutes of human eyes or a bowlcut on his slimy little head.<br>These things could happen while the PCs are in Kevin\u2019s presence, or have been witnessed by a GMC. Maybe the GMC functions as a clue dispenser, or maybe they\u2019re losing their shit following a failed Unnatural check, and now they pose a danger to the PCs.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Your Worst Nightmare: If the PCs threaten Patricia (including outing her authority as a magickal farce), she can go all Rambo on them \u2013 see the Cinemancy formula spells as a starting point.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">False Flag: If the PCs go to the police at any point, it will sooner or later come to light that Patricia is not who she claims she is. This will likely kick off Your Worst Nightmare, and could easily lead to the cops wasting a lot of the PCs\u2019 time and generally obstructing their efforts, if not just arresting them. This is also bad news for most of the GMCs listed above. Depending on how much information has ben gleaned, and how much is then shared with the cops, a manhunt for Kevin is not out of the question.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Transformation: Kevin\u2019s body is again taken over by the bullfrog for 1d10 hours. Ideally, deploy this one in the midst of a conversation with someone who\u2019s seen Kevin recently, and\/or in a context that would make his\u2026 being a bullfrog, and always having been one a mindfuck. Especially if the PCs are local ponies, this is one of the GM\u2019s best opportunities for a big Unnatural check. Also feel free to fudge the exact point he turns back for similar dramatic effect.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">The Bullfrog Strikes Again: The demon gains control of Kevin\u2019s body for another 1d10 hours and kills another child in horrific fashion, with even less effort toward covering its tracks as it continues to indulge its Urge.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Too Many Cooks: A group pursuing one of the objectives your players didn\u2019t pick from the three above gets in their way or misconstrues their involvement for complicity in something really bad.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>Inverting the Objective System<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Try this as an experiment for using the Objective system for a one-shot: the players know what their objective is from the outset, but aren\u2019t given any milestones. Once you\u2019re almost out of time and ready for a climactic last scene and\/or denouement, consult the list of milestones below. Let the players roll the points for each one they completed, plus any other noteworthy actions they took that aren\u2019t listed that you feel should still count.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Then, (in the likely event they are below 100%) have them roll it as a kind of oracle (in the solo RPG sense). Suggestions for a final scene are listed under the different Endings sections, based on the level of success.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">The milestones can also help you as GM figure out where to steer the PCs, since most clues are not tied to specific GMCs.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Petty milestones<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">&#8211; Interrogate Kevin\u2019s host family, teachers, or classmates<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">&#8211; Interrogate<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">&#8211; Use minor charge(s) to try and locate Kevin<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">&#8211; Sic the police on one or more involved parties<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">&#8211; Provide proof of Kevin\u2019s location and\/or status to a relevant authority<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">&#8211; Prove to a relevant authority that Kevin has not been acting entirely of his own volition<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Weighty milestones<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">&#8211; Interrogate Patricia Albrici about<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">&#8211; Use gutter magick or significant charge(s) to try and locate Kevin<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">&#8211; Kidnap, seriously injure, or traumatize one or more involved parties<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">&#8211; Take action to directly ensure Kevin is permanently prevented from harming himself or others<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">&#8211; Exoricse the lycanthropic demon (through some means outside the scope written here)<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>Endings: Sleepers<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">00: Kevin transforms somewhere public and wakes the tiger.
